Package org.omnifaces.component.messages

Examples of org.omnifaces.component.messages.OmniMessages


  public void encodeChildren(FacesContext context, UIComponent component) throws IOException {
    if (!component.isRendered()) {
      return;
    }

    OmniMessages omniMessages = (OmniMessages) component;
    List<FacesMessage> messages = getMessages(context, omniMessages);

    if (!isEmpty(omniMessages.getVar()) && omniMessages.getChildCount() > 0) {
      encodeMessagesRepeater(context, omniMessages, messages);
    }
    else if (messages.isEmpty()) {
      encodeEmptyMessages(context, omniMessages);
    }
    else {
      String message = omniMessages.getMessage();

      if (!isEmpty(message)) {
        messages = Arrays.asList(createInfo(message));
      }

      encodeMessages(context, omniMessages, messages, "table".equals(omniMessages.getLayout()));
    }
  }
View Full Code Here

TOP

Related Classes of org.omnifaces.component.messages.OmniMessages

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.